Condensation control

Condensation can give surfaces such as floors and walls an unpleasant smell, causing mildew spores to circulate and negatively affect woodwork. Double glazing reduces condensation by keeping the inner glass's surface warm. However if windows are not set up properly, moisture may seep through the gap between the panes, and damage the window seal. It is also possible for moisture to form between the glass and the frame when the window is attached to an existing brick wall. In these instances it is necessary to replace the entire window is required.

A faulty seal is usually the reason for condensation between the panes of double-glazed windows. This can be caused by the degeneration of the sealant which allows air to enter the space between the windows and reacts with moisture in the air to form condensation. Additionally, cheaper double-glazed windows usually use rubber strips instead of silicone as a sealant, which can speed up condensation.

A good double-glazing installer will ensure that the sealant around the edges of the frames is correctly applied and that the gaps are sealed to stop cold air from entering your home. They should also offer a comprehensive service after the installation to ensure you are satisfied with their work.

If double-glazed windows are installed in your home, you can expect to notice some condensation on the outside of the window, but this is usually an indication that the window is functioning well and is efficient in thermal terms. This kind of condensation usually occurs during the night or early morning hours, when temperatures are low and wind is minimal. You can lessen the amount of condensation on your windows by installing extractor fans in kitchens and bathrooms, and by using a dehumidifier for your home.
